Repeated and said
Repeated what he had already said.
("If someone seized by an epileptic fit said, ‘Write a bill of divorce for my wife,’ he has said nothing. If he said, ‘Write a bill of divorce for my wife,’ and then was seized by an epileptic fit and went back and said, ‘Do not write it,’ his later words mean nothing" — Gittin 7a; and also: "And Father goes back and says: / Leave him for a day — / he will leave you for two days / The wagon is moving; there is no stopping" — Meir Ariel, The Snake’s Nest)
